They rose to international comedy acclaim through their 2005 BBC radio series and an HBO sitcom which ran from 2007-2009. Combining deadpan humour and parody songs, the Emmy-nominated series followed fictionalised versions of their lives in New York City.
The duo signed a record deal with Sub Pop Records for their recorded music, releasing the Grammy-winning EP, The Distant Future in 2007, followed by their self-titled full length debut in 2008, I Told You I Was Freaky in 2009, and Live In London in 2019.
They have headlined concerts in the United States and the United Kingdom, including a successful Flight of the Conchords Sing Flight of the Conchords Tour in 2016.
The Conchords have enjoyed individual success outside the band.
Clement is the co-creator of the comedy horror TV shows Wellington Paranormal and What We Do In The Shadows.
Most recently he starred as Dr. Garvin in the last two Avatar films The Way of Water in 2022 and Fire and Ash in 2025.
McKenzie was the songwriter for The Muppets, which won him an Academy Award for Best Original Song. He’s also written songs for TV and film, including The Simpsons and The Minecraft Movie.
